Movimentação de TP e SL
18 respostas
CTC
8 anos atrás #113786
Hi,
Estou tentando fazer isso:
if OpenProfit(magicBuy) > Variable1 then
Mover SL para CurrentPrice - Variable1 e
MoveTP to min(currentPrice+TP + Variable2,CurrentPrice+MaxTP) (ou seja, se maxTp for atingido, eu fecho a ordem)
.
Como isso é feito?
Anexei um exemplo de SQW para sua consideração...
Considere que os MagicNumbers são variáveis, pois o EA pode ser executado em pares diferentes.
Muito obrigado,
Cláudio
tomas262
8 anos atrás #131678
Posso estar errado, mas vejo magicNoSell com um pequeno "m" no início, o que pode ser a causa da mensagem de erro.
CTC
8 anos atrás #131694
M é maiúsculo no anexo. O erro é o mesmo. Além disso, a alteração do MagicNo não é aceita no segundo. Veja o anexo...
Obrigado
tomas262
8 anos atrás #131749
Olá,
Tentei alterar o número mágico de Buy para Sell e consegui sem problemas. Você só precisa clicar dentro da condição no membro mais profundo usando o botão "...".
Também editado em Adjust SL "Market position is Long" em "Market position is Short"
Veja em anexo